:root{--primary:#e2572d;--primaryLight:#ffba43;--secondary:#ffba43;--secondaryLight:#ffba43;--headerColor:#1a1a1a;--bodyTextColor:#4e4b66;--bodyTextColorWhite:#fafbfc;--topperFontSize:clamp(0.8125rem, 1.6vw, 1rem);--headerFontSize:clamp(1.9375rem, 3.9vw, 3.0625rem);--bodyFontSize:1rem;--sectionPadding:clamp(3.75rem, 7.82vw, 4.25rem) 1rem}html{scroll-behavior:smooth}body{margin:0;padding:0;font-family:"Nunito", sans-serif;font-weight:400}a{text-decoration:none;color:#e7643d;font-weight:bold}a:hover{text-decoration:underline}*,*:after,*:before{box-sizing:border-box}.cs-topper{font-size:var(--topperFontSize);line-height:1.2em;text-transform:uppercase;text-align:inherit;letter-spacing:0.1em;font-weight:700;color:var(--primary);margin-bottom:0.25rem;display:block}.cs-title{font-size:var(--headerFontSize);font-family:"Nunito", sans-serif;font-weight:800;line-height:1.2em;text-align:inherit;max-width:43.75rem;margin:0 0 1rem;color:var(--headerColor);position:relative}.cs-text{font-size:var(--bodyFontSize);font-family:"Nunito", sans-serif;font-weight:400;line-height:1.5em;text-align:inherit;width:100%;max-width:40.625rem;margin:0;color:var(--bodyTextColor)}